About

Bulwell Forest ward lies in the northern part of the city of Nottingham. The area is primarily residential, featuring a mix of housing types from Victorian terraces to more modern developments. It is bordered by the wider Bulwell area to the west and the open spaces of Bestwood Country Park to the east, providing a direct link to substantial woodland and heathland.

The ward takes its name from the local Bulwell Forest Park, a central green space with recreational facilities. A notable local landmark is the distinctive, historic Bulwell Hall, which sits within the park's grounds. The area is served by local shopping provisions along Main Street and has good public transport connections into Nottingham city centre.

Area overview

On average Bulwell Forest has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 74 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 15.5%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Bulwell Forest is £43,416 per year. There are 6 schools in Bulwell Forest: 5 primary (0 Outstanding and 5 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Bulwell Forest is home to around 13,997 people, with a population density of about 4,223.7 per km2.

Property prices in Bulwell Forest

Based on 162 recent sales, the median property price is £200,000 in Bulwell Forest area, with individual transactions ranging from £45,000 up to £25,500,000.
